> On 06/24/2014 01:54 AM, Laurent Pinchart wrote:
>> The v4l2_pix_format structure has no reserved field. It is embedded in
>> the v4l2_framebuffer structure which has no reserved fields either, and
>> in the v4l2_format structure which has reserved fields that were not
>> previously required to be zeroed out by applications.
>>
>> To allow extending v4l2_pix_format, inline it in the v4l2_framebuffer
>> structure, and use the priv field as a magic value to indicate that the
>> application has set all v4l2_pix_format extended fields and zeroed all
>> reserved fields following the v4l2_pix_format field in the v4l2_format
>> structure.
>>
>> The availability of this API extension is reported to userspace through
>> the new V4L2_CAP_EXT_PIX_FORMAT capability flag. Just checking that the
>> priv field is still set to the magic value at [GS]_FMT return wouldn't
>> be enough, as older kernels don't zero the priv field on return.
>>
>> To simplify the internal API towards drivers zero the extended fields
>> and set the priv field to the magic value for applications not aware of
>> the extensions.
>>

> It should be ORed to cap->device_caps as well.

But only if cap->capabilities sets V4L2_CAP_DEVICE_CAPS.

Should we unconditionally add this flag or only if CAP_VIDEO_CAPTURE or
CAP_VIDEO_OUTPUT is set?

So we could do this:

        if (cap->capabilities & (V4L2_CAP_VIDEO_CAPTURE | 
V4L2_CAP_VIDEO_OUTPUT))
                cap->capabilities |= V4L2_CAP_EXT_PIX_FORMAT;
        if ((cap->capabilities & V4L2_CAP_DEVICE_CAPS) &&
            (cap->device_caps & (V4L2_CAP_VIDEO_CAPTURE | 
V4L2_CAP_VIDEO_OUTPUT))
                cap->device_caps |= V4L2_CAP_EXT_PIX_FORMAT;


I can argue either direction: on the one hand ext_pix_format handling is part
of the v4l2 core, so it is valid for all that use it, on the other hand it
makes no sense for a non-video device.

My preference would be to set it only in combination with video capture/output
since it just looks peculiar otherwise.
